Definitions

Definition of terms.

Name 
Description 
Analog Input sample or data from an individual analog input channel. 
A group of analog input samples defined by the number of channels for a burst operation. When an ADC-burst is started, the timing between samples is controlled by the Analog Input Burst Timer or in classic mode it is defined strictly as 5 microseconds. 
Analog Input Sample Event is a signal that causes either an analog input sample or analog input burst, depending on how the STX104 is set up. 
A Frame is a generalized term. This is the record that is deposited per frame time into the FIFO memory. Currently, a frame is the equivalent to an ADC-Burst in terms of the amount of samples stored in the FIFO. 
Intra-sample refers to time between analog input samples within an ADC-burst operation.
